A 26-week treatment, multi-center, randomized, double-blind, double dummy, parallel-group study to assess the efficacy, safety and tolerability of QVA149 compared to fluticasone/salmeterol in patients with moderate to severe chronic obstructive pulmonary disease

入选标准
- •1. Male or female adults aged =40 years, who have signed an Informed Consent Form prior to initiation of any study-related procedure.
- •2. Patients with moderate to severe stable COPD (Stage II or Stage III) according to the GOLD Guidelines 2009.
- •3. Current or ex-smokers who have a smoking history of at least 10 pack years. (Ten pack-years are defined as 20 cigarettes a day for 10 years, or 10 cigarettes a day for 20 years etc.)
- •4. Patients with a post-bronchodilator FEV1 =40% and < 80% of the predicted normal, and post-bronchodilator FEV1/FVC < 0.7 at Visit 2 (Day -14).
- •(Post refers to 1 hour after sequential inhalation of 84 µg (or equivalent dose) of ipratropium bromide and 400 µg of salbutamol)
- •5. Symptomatic patients, according to daily electronic diary data between Visit 2 (-14) and Visit 3 (Day 1), with a total score of 1 or more on at least 4 of the last 7 days.

排除标准
- •1. Pregnant women or nursing mothers (pregnancy confirmed by
- •positive urine pregnancy test).
- •2. Women of child-bearing potential (WOCBP) except under certain
- •circumstances (see protocol).
- •3. Patients contraindicated for treatment with, or having a history of
- •reactions/ hypersensitivity to any of the following inhaled drugs, drugs
- •of a similar class or any component thereof:
- •4. Patients with a history of long QT syndrome or whose QTc measured
- •at Visit 2 (Day -14) (Fridericia method) is prolonged (>450 ms for males
- •and females) as confirmed by the central ECG assessor.
- •5. Patients who have a clinically significant abnormality on the Visit 2
- •ECG who in the judgment of the investigator would be at potential risk if
- •enrolled into the study. (These patients should not be re-screened).
- •6. Patients with Type I or uncontrolled Type II diabetes.
- •7. Patients who have not achieved an acceptable spirometry result at
- •Visit 2 in accordance with ATS/ERS criteria for acceptability and
- •repeatability
- •8. Patients with narrow-angle glaucoma, symptomatic prostatic
- •hyperplasia or bladder-neck obstruction or moderate to severe renal
- •impairment or urinary retention. (Patients with a transurethral resection
- •of prostate (TURP) are excluded from the study. Patients who have
- •undergone full re-section of the prostate may be considered for the
- •study, as well as patients who are asymptomatic and stable on
- •pharmacological treatment for the condition).
- •9. Patients with a history of malignancy of any organ system (including
- •lung cancer), treated or untreated, within the past 5 years whether or
- •not there is evidence of local recurrence or metastases, with the
- •exception of localized basal cell carcinoma of the skin.
- •10. Patients who, in the judgment of the investigator, have a clinically
- •relevant laboratory abnormality or a clinically significant condition
- •11. Patients unable to use an electronic patient diary.
- •12. Patients who are, in the opinion of the investigator known to be
- •unreliable or non-compliant.
- •COPD specific exclusion
- •13. Patients requiring long term oxygen therapy on a daily basis for
- •chronic hypoxemia.
- •14. Patients who have had a COPD exacerbation that required treatment
- •with antibiotics, systemic steroids (oral or intravenous) or
- •hospitalization in the last year up to and including Visit 3.
- •15. Patients who have had a respiratory tract infection within 4 weeks
- •prior to Visit 1. Patients who develop an upper or lower respiratory tract
- •infection during the screening period (up to Visit 3) will not be eligible,
- •but will be permitted to be re-screened 4 weeks after the resolution of
- •the respiratory tract infection.
- •16. Patients with concomitant pulmonary disease, e.g. pulmonary
- •tuberculosis (unless confirmed by chest x-ray to be no longer active) or
- •clinically significant bronchiectasis, sarcoidosis, interstitial lung disorder
- •or pulmonary hypertension.
- •17. Patients with lung lobectomy, lung volume reduction, or lung
- •transplantation.
